With scaling of technology feature sizes, the share of leakage in total power consumption of digital systems continues to grow. Conventional dynamic voltage scaling (DVS) techniques fail to accurately address the impact of scaling on system power consumption and hence, are incapable of achieving energy efficient solutions.
